Brook, Indiana g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 87.3,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 12.7% lower than the U.S. average and 4.3% lower than the average for Indiana.

Brook, IN

Housing costs in Brook?
A typical home costs $141,500, which is 58.1%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 36.1% less expensive than the average Indiana home, at $221,600.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Brook costs $820 per month, which is 42.7%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 19.5% cheaper than the state average of $980.

Can I afford Brook?
To live comfortably in Brook, Indiana, a minimum annual income of $27,000 for a family, and $26,800 for a single person is recommended.
